Chirac visits dead bomb suspect's home
Vaulx-en-Velin, France - President Jacques Chirac held talks in the home town of Khaled Kelkal, an Algerian-born suspect in a string of bombings who was shot dead by police. Mr Chirac met community leaders and activists. Kelkal, was gunned down by paramilitary gendarmes as he tried to escape a police dragnet two weeks ago. Reuter
